No Experience with the AVS U+4s, but I do have experience with Tire
Rack.  Against the recommendation of a 'lister' (Andrew Duane and his Pal)
I bought Pirelli P500's because Tire Rack said they had better grip
and were quieter than the BFG Comp T/A's.  They were wrong.  The P500's
are ok on Snow/Wet, but they S**K on dry.  Andrew had had a pair of 
P500's and told me not to buy them.  Since then he now has the Comp T/A
and seems pretty happy :-)  Did I get that Right Andrew ?

The listers here have nothing to gain by steering you one way or 
another, but Tire Rack Does.  They may have a better profit margin
on the AVS or there overstocked, or maybe they're actually are
better....

Caveat Emptor my friend....
